Distorted sound perception and subjective benefit after stapedotomy – a prospective single-centre study.

Objective: To evaluate the quality of perceived sound after stapedotomy over a 1-year follow-up period focussing on incidence of dysacusis, particularly distorted sound perception (DSP).
